Ohio State wins 3rd straight pistol national title
Ohio State won its third consecutive pistol national championship at the Intercollegiate Pistol Championships in Anniston and Talladega, Alabama.
Katelyn Abeln took first place in the three-event aggregate and air pistol events. Maria Tsarik was the individual winner in the sport pistol and standard pistol.
The Buckeyes swept the top three spots in every team and individual event. First-team All-americans were Abeln, Tsarik, Jackson Leverett, Abbie Leverett and Panagiota Charalampous.
Ohio State’s Sasso takes 2nd in NCAA wrestling
Ohio State’s Sammy Sasso finished second in the NCAA wrestling championships at 149 pounds following a 4-2 loss by decision to No. 1 Yianni Diakomihalis of Cornell in Tulsa, Oklahoma.
Sasso, a four-time All-american, finished the 2022-23 season with a 29-4 record. As a team, Ohio State finished fourth, giving coach Tom Ryan his 14th top-10 and ninth top-finish since 200607.
Buckeyes 6th in NCAA women’s swimming
Ohio State finished sixth in the NCAA women’s swimming and diving championships in Knoxville, Tennessee, the highest finish in program history. It is the third straight top-10 finish for the Buckeyes.
Eleven Buckeyes won All-american honors: Hannah Bach (100 breast, 200 medley relay); Jessica Eden (800 free relay); Amy Fulmer (200 free relay, 200 medley relay, 400 free relay, 50 free, 100 free, 200 free, 800 free relay); Nyah
Funderburke (200 medley relay, 200 free relay, 400 medley relay); Maya Geringer ( 1650 free); Lena Hentschel (1-meter dive, 3-meter dive); Teresa Ivan (50 free, 200 medley relay, 200 free relay, 400 free relay); Josie Panitz (100 breast, 400 medley relay); Felicia Pasadyn (400 IM, 800 free relay); Catherine Russo (400 free relay); Katherine Zenick (100 fly, 100 free, 200 medley relay, 200 free relay, 200 medley relay, 400 free relay, 800 free relay).
